Writing Specialist

Academic Support Service for Student Athletes (ASSSA) is designed to assist student athletes with reaching their fullest academic and personal development while at the University of Pittsburgh. The University, Department of Athletics and ASSSA are committed to promoting both academic and athletic achievement of its student athletes, while upholding the academic integrity of the institution. The staff of ASSSA will work closely with coaches and faculty to help student athletes balance the demands of their academic responsibilities and participation in intercollegiate athletics.

ASSSA is seeking a Writing Specialist that will work with the Director of Writing Services in assisting student athletes with their academic, professional, and creative writing assignments, while also improving reading comprehension and understanding of the writing process. In this role, the specialist will maintain a caseload of student athletes who require consistent writing support, act as the liaison with writing faculty, and create and implement various workshops to assist in the writing process. The position requires a comprehensive understanding of the unique challenges student athletes face and the ability to provide holistic support that integrates both academic and athletic success.

A bachelor's degree in English Writing or a closely related field is required. Strong applicants will have professional experience as a writing or tutorial instructor.
